2. Difficulties Of Reusing Solar Panels



It is extensively approved that recycling photovoltaic panels has lots of environmental benefits, nevertheless, it is also real that the process isn't without its obstacles. Yet what exactly are these challenges? Allow's investigate further.



Among the greatest problems with reusing solar panels is the complexity of the job itself. It can be difficult to break down the various parts, such as glass and steel, to be reused separately. In addition, solar panel producers frequently have a mix of materials used in their items that makes arranging them much more difficult. Moreover, there are safety and health and wellness threats included with handling damaged glass or inhaling fumes from melting parts.

3. Strategies For Reusing Solar Panels



As the world pursues a much more sustainable future, reusing photovoltaic panels is a progressively preferred job. In the middle of this expanding passion, nonetheless, we should consider the approaches that are in location to make it feasible.

To begin with, many business have implemented a 'take-back' system where old or broken photovoltaic panels can be collected and sent to their corresponding factories for reusing. In this manner, the materials have the ability to be recycled in the construction of new items. Additionally, some communities have even started offering rewards for people desiring to recycle their solar panels; this might vary from tax breaks to totally free shipping prices.

Furthermore, modern technology has actually become increasingly advanced when it comes to reusing solar panels-- with specialist makers capable of separating out all the various elements within them. For instance, by using AI-powered robot arms, these machines can draw out valuable materials such as copper and aluminium while additionally dealing with hazardous waste safely.
